GP @ The Grove

This service brings together Haringey GP practices and patients who are accessing support from The Grove Drug Treatment Service and HAGA Action on Alcohol.

The service is based at The Grove Drug Treatment Service and HAGA in Tottenham. Clinics are available to patients who are already working with either organisation.

The service focuses on addressing the wider health needs of patients who are engaged in addiction recovery and therapy services.

 

About the service

Patients accessing treatment and recovery services often experience complex health needs alongside barriers to accessing healthcare. By supporting patients to develop a clear, coordinated care plan, the service aims to help both patients and professionals feel more confident and supported in improving health outcomes. The service works alongside recovery teams and the patient’s registered GP, promoting collaboration and a ‘team around the patient’ approach.

 

What patients can expect

Patients benefit from:

  • A 45-minute face-to-face assessment with a GP
  • A comprehensive care plan, covering physical health, mental health and recovery needs
  • One-to-one support from a wellbeing advocate, helping patients access additional services, navigate wider challenges, and act as a point of contact between the patient and other professionals

Impact:

April 2025 to January 2026

  • Over 70 patients seen from 174 appointments provided.
  • 64 new referrals were accepted by the service
